How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    Are you an experienced Technical Author looking to work with cutting-edge engineering products that are used globally? Do you want to work for world class manufacturer in the engineering sector? If you answered yes, then we invite you to read on!
    An exciting opportunity has opened up within our clients a long-standing and highly skilled technical publications team. You’ll be joining a friendly and supportive team who are responsible for producing and updating high-quality technical documents, specifications, and engineering drawings for global customers.
    What You’ll Be Doing:
    * Creating and updating technical publications, build plans, and test procedures used by manufacturing and customer teams
    * Interpreting and referencing engineering drawings, CAD models, production standards, and support analysis records
    * Collaborating with engineering, design, and production departments to resolve technical queries
    * Reviewing and proofreading documents to meet internal quality and compliance requirements
    * Participating in hands-on validation using tooling, equipment, and engineering processes
    What You’ll Bring:
    * Strong experience producing technical publications within engineering/manufacturing
    * Excellent understanding of industry standards and technical communication methods
    * Practical exposure to mechanical engineering concepts and simplified technical English
    * Able to communicate effectively and work independently or as part of a team
    * Detail-oriented, with a strong focus on quality and consistency
    * Relevant qualifications (e.g. City & Guilds in Technical Communication & Authoring or similar) are beneficial, but not required,
